Home

szyfrowaniem

Szyfrowanie to proces przekształcania danych w formę nieczytelną dla osób nieuprawnionych przy użyciu algorytmu kryptograficznego i klucza. Celem jest ochrona poufności danych podczas przechowywania lub transmisji. Dane przed szyfrowaniem nazywane są tekstem jawnym, a po zaszyfrowaniu – tekstem zaszyfrowanym; deszyfrowanie pozwala na odczytanie pierwotnych danych.

Szyfrowanie dzieli się na dwie podstawowe kategorie: szyfrowanie symetryczne i asymetryczne. W szyfrowaniu symetrycznym ten sam

Zastosowania obejmują ochronę komunikacji w sieciach (np. TLS), ochronę danych w spoczynku (szyfrowanie dysków), szyfrowanie poczty

klucz
służy
do
szyfrowania
i
deszyfrowania;
jest
szybkie
i
efektywne
przy
dużych
ilościach
danych
(np.
AES).
W
szyfrowaniu
asymetrycznym
używa
się
pary
kluczy:
klucza
publicznego
do
zaszyfrowania
i
klucza
prywatnego
do
deszyfrowania;
umożliwia
to
bezpieczną
wymianę
kluczy
i
podpisywanie.
Przykłady
to
RSA
i
ECC.
Aby
zapewnić
integralność
i
autentyczność
źródła,
często
stosuje
się
dodatkowe
mechanizmy
uwierzytelniania,
takie
jak
MAC
(kod
uwierzytelniania
wiadomości)
lub
podpis
cyfrowy,
ponieważ
same
algorytmy
szyfrowania
nie
gwarantują
autentyczności.
elektronicznej
i
plików,
a
także
zabezpieczenia
w
VPN
i
wielu
protokołach
internetowych.
Skuteczność
szyfrowania
zależy
od
siły
używanego
algorytmu,
długości
klucza,
jakości
implementacji
oraz
właściwego
zarządzania
kluczami.
W
praktyce
ważne
jest
stosowanie
aktualnych
standardów
i
unikanie
przestarzałych
algorytmów,
a
także
monitorowanie
konfiguracji
i
środowiska
pod
kątem
podatności.